DB Insurance Signs MOU with Seoul Fintech Lab to Promote Insurtech Development View original image

[Asia Economy Reporter Ki Ha-young] DB Insurance announced on the 19th that it has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) with Seoul Fintech Lab to "promote Insurtech services."


The signing ceremony, held online the previous day, was attended by DB Insurance Vice President Ko Young-joo, Seoul Fintech Lab Center Director So Young, and officials from both companies.


Through this agreement, the two parties plan to jointly plan and execute various collaboration programs, including ▲joint discovery and nurturing of startups in the Insurtech field ▲review of Insurtech business cooperation ▲providing Insurtech-related consulting to startups being nurtured and collaborated with.


DB Insurance Vice President Ko Young-joo said, "Through this agreement, we hope to achieve concrete business results in the Insurtech field so that both parties can win-win," adding, "We will continue to collaborate for the growth of Insurtech startups."



Meanwhile, Seoul Fintech Lab is a fintech incubation center operated by the Seoul Metropolitan Government. It provides fintech startups with office space for up to two years and offers one-stop services including customized professional accelerating programs according to growth stages, investment attraction, and overseas expansion.
